Back To Nature with William Morris

This week, having previously investigated William Morris, Year 4 really did get 'back to nature' designing and creating pictures using natural materials foraged from the wild life area and donated by a kindly local flower stall owner. The results were AMAZING! 
A lot of children naturally incorporated some William Morris symmetry. The following photos were taken soon after they were created, but over the weeks the pictures will change before our very eyes as they gradually decompose.
The children worked in pairs using A3 paper, which had been tea-stained then photocopied, to give an older Victorian feel to their pictures.












Most of us decided to use just natural materials, but a few of us added in some extra patterns in the spaces in ink. 




Meanwhile this class, used a bouquet on white paper, giving a crisper, modern feel to their pictures.
